Re: Part Location

No John, it's the round disc flat washer with two drilled holes in it. No good with photos, but there is a drawing in the 1940's partlist.

Dave

email (option): jeepfinger@blueyonder.co.uk

Re: Part Location

Dave,

it is got two holes because on a pre war bike which had the same washer a horn bracket was fitted beneath the stud on the forks with an extra hole for an attachment bolt behind the stud. How is that for getting rid of surplus stock

Re: Part Location

Thanks all for your replies.

I think now that the washer should be on TOP of the mudguard. The reasoning for this,
I have just been looking at the photo of C4347367, looks like factory, it has the distance piece between forks and mudguard, the washer can be seen on top of the mudguard. My bike C4343114 hasn't got that distance piece, and never has in all the time that I have owned her. I do know that there where different length forks, but don't know where mine fall into

Leon, that you for the explanaton of the extra hole. That would make sense, the washer on top so the horn bracket came of it. As for using up stock, I only got the washer from Russell's a couple of years ago

Re: Part Location

Hi Ray,
Here's a photo of the washer, it's 3inch in diameter with 5/16 centre hole and a 1/4 hole 1/2 from edge of dish. I have any mic's, so the nearest thickness is 1/32ths.
Ray, your photo is from C9310 mine is from C7287, the gap in the rib on the mudguard isn't wide enough, but in your photo the dish looks to bend up.
